Thousands of FirstEnergy customers in Northeast Ohio are without power due to severe thunderstorms, including nearly 31,000 in Cuyahoga County. Over 13,000 outages were reported in Cleveland as of 10 p.m. More than 4,400 outages reported in Geauga County, over 6,700 in Lake County, and nearly 12,000 across Lorain. The National Weather Service issued a flash flood warning for northeast Cuyhoga County, west central Geaug County and southwestern Lake County. The storms reportedly caused significant rainfall and caused damage to small creeks and streams, urban areas, highways, streets and underpasses.
